Fly to Catania Airport, 18km from Nicolosi. From there, take a taxi or bus. Domestic travellers can also drive (220km from Palermo, 85km from Messina). No direct water transport available.
The most convenient airport for Nicolosi, Italy is Catania-Fontanarossa Airport, due to its proximity and frequent flights. It's approximately 30 kilometres away, making it a short journey for both domestic and international travellers.
Nicolosi, Italy, is a small town best navigated on foot or by bicycle. There's no public transport within the town, but taxis are available. For longer distances, the AST bus company provides services to nearby cities. Always check the latest schedules. Car hire is also an option, with several rental companies operating in the area.

Anyone staying in Nicolosi for a holiday needs their own transport. Sicily is not like Malta and doesn't have a good public bus service, sadly.
Also you need to be a very confident driver if you are considering hiring a car there. It's every man/woman for himself.
The only other way to get around is by booking tours, which do seem to be plentiful.
Plenty of good places in Nicolosi to eat and well stocked supermarkets.
My only criticism really is the amount or rubbish left on the road sides, which seems such a shame for such a beautiful civilised place and is something that local councils really need to address.
